21st Century is an afterschool program running Monday-Thursday that offers academic enrichment including tutoring for homework, life-skills, college prep, and other activities while being able to socialize among your peers. Program will be starting next week, however students may join at any time. Everyday attendance for students is not mandatory although it is suggested and we have two teaching/ tutoring positions available for teachers who are interested.
